This Graph Shows Which Areas in The U.S. Have the Highest Concentration of STDs (In Case You Were Wondering)
December 30, 2012
[Editor's note: The following subject material may not be suitable for all ages.]
First off: Gross.
Second, we feel sorry for whoever had to put together the following graph on the areas in the U.S. with the highest rates of STDs per 100,000 people. Because, again, gross:
Click for larger image (Courtesy: BestMedicalDegrees.com)
Big takeaways: Chlamydia is way more common than it should be, there’s something really weird going on in the South (the highest occurrences of chlamydia, gonorrhea, andsyphilis?) and the Northeast has the unfortunate distinction of being the region with the highest concentration of Aids victims.
